What This Review Looks At
An attorney examines W-4 and state forms along with credits like retirement saver and education incentives. They check filing status, itemized options, and timing strategies to align withholdings with your situation.
Why This Process Gains Attention Now
Remote work moves and multi-state income complicate withholding. People look for clarity and control on refunds. Research shows proactive planning reduces surprises and supports year round cash flow goals.
